IndianaJet Posted March 4, 2019 Share Posted March 4, 2019 If the Giants are really interested in bring in a rookie QB like Haskins, I can't see them trading one of the best WRs in the league. Say what you want about his attitude, but why would they invest a high pick in a QB then take away his best option? It's like setting your QB up for failure. I also don't buy the Giants won't trade with the Jets angle....when it comes down to it, trading from 6 to 2 is a lot more expensive then from 6 to 3. You can't let silly things like a supposed "rivalry" get in the way of a smart business decision. Last year the Jets traded up to 3 and not 2 because they knew they could still get one of their QBs there. Same thing this year. Why trade to 2 when it's more than likely Haskins will still be there at 3.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

nycdan Posted March 5, 2019 Share Posted March 5, 2019 It would actually work very well for the 49ers. OBJ needs to be in a place where he is the sole focus of the offense. If he's not getting all the attention, he will pout and then get 'injured'. The 49ers are perfect in that they don't have a star WR. Kittle is a great TE who will help spread things out but as long as he doesn't vulture too many TD opps in the red zone, it can work. If SF wants to challenge the Rams, it's not a bad idea and at 6, they can still get a really good player. Ferrell and Devin White would both fill big needs for them. Having said that, I can't see this trade happening. Giants would be getting about the same value for Beckham that OAK got for Cooper. Don't see Gettleman doing that. If they got SFs 3rd rounder back, then maybe it can make a bit more sense.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
